Q:  What is NOT included in my cruise fare?

Dining in speciality restaurants and snacking at cafes and lounges, “steakhouse selections” in the main dining room, pizza anywhere delivery, 24-hour room service, alcoholic and some non-alcoholic beverages, speciality coffees, bottled water, energy drinks, sodas (unless you buy Bottomless Bubbles or Cheers), gambling in the casino, spa treatments, internet packages, photos & photo packages, and shore excursions. 

Q:  What cruise ship gratuities will I need to pay?  These are 2026 suggestions for tipping.

  • $16.00 per person, per day for standard statements
  • $18.00 per person, per day for suites
  • This covers the dining team, stateroom attendants, and other service staff
  • Bar purchases automatically add an 18% gratuity
  • You can prepay before departure

Q:  Will my mobile phone work at sea?

  • Your phone will connect to Cellular at Sea, which is VERY expensive (roaming charges).
  • Calls, texts, and data can cost $2–$10+ per minute/MB depending on your carrier.

          Best Option

Buy Carnival’s Wi‑Fi plan:

  • Social Plan (cheapest)
  • Value Plan
  • Premium Plan (fastest)

Carnival Wi‑Fi Pricing (Typical Rates)

  1. Social Wi‑Fi Plan

Access to: Facebook, Instagram, WhatsApp, Messenger, Twitter, TikTok, Snapchat

Price: $12.75 per person, per day (if purchased pre‑cruise)

Price:  $15.00 per person, per day (if purchased onboard)

  1. Value Wi‑Fi Plan

Access to: Social + email + news + sports + weather + banking (No streaming, no video calls)

Price: $17.00 per person, per day (pre‑cruise)

Price:  $20.00 per person, per day (onboard)

  1. Premium Wi‑Fi Plan

Fastest connection, supports:

  • Video calls (FaceTime, Zoom)
  • Streaming (Netflix, Hulu, YouTube)
  • Full internet access

Price: $18.70 per person, per day (pre‑cruise)

Price:   $22.00 per person, per day (onboard)

Important Notes

  • Prices are per person, not per cabin.
  • You can buy Wi‑Fi for just one day or the entire cruise.
  • Pre‑purchasing is always cheaper.
  • Speeds vary at sea — Premium is the only plan that streams reliably.
